At its July meeting the board approved multiple consent items including street closures for Yale and the New Haven Street Festival, police donations and equipment purchases, numerous tax-assistance/abatement petitions, and education committee amendments updating school roof grant amounts for Hillhouse, Truman and other projects.

The New Haven Board of Alders approved a series of consent items that included temporary street closures for university and festival events, acceptance of police donations, purchases for the K‑9 unit, multiple tax-assistance and abatement requests, and amendments to school-construction grant applications.

A chief of police item asked the board to accept donations totaling $55,000; the board moved and seconded the item on the consent calendar and approved it without recorded opposition in the excerpt. The police request also included a $500 purchase for a K‑9 from Red Devil Canine (Florida) and an equipment donation valued at $2,400 for patrol K‑9 needs; those items were handled on consent and approved.
